Responsibilities
Serves as the point of contact for RSM USI individuals and rotators assigned to system of quality management testing. Acts as a liaison with control owners and completes an initial review of any work performed by RSM USI.
Performs walkthroughs, design and implementation testing, operating effectiveness testing, identification of exceptions, potential findings and deficiencies as well as timely and accurate communication of results.
Assists the AQRM-SOQM Lead Manager with monitoring of the firm’s system of quality management and development of project timelines. Communicates project status and achievement of key milestones.
Perform remediation testing.
Assist with the development of innovation testing techniques and proactive monitoring development.
Assist with report development and presentation materials for AQRM Leadership, the Quality Management Risk Committee (including the National Assurance Leader and Chief Risk Officer), and the Chief Executive Officer.
Other duties as assigned.
Qualification

Required
Bachelor’s degree
Strong oral and written communications skills
Ability to communicate information clearly and concisely, verbally and orally to diverse audiences across the firm
Ability to develop and maintain applicable professional and internal contacts, resources and networks
Ability to maintain confidentiality and discretion with respect to internal information
Exhibit high attention to detail and strong proofreading skills
3+ years’ relevant experience
Controls testing experience
Able to adapt quickly to changes in the firm and regulatory environment
Ability to work independently and collaboratively
Proactive in requesting feedback
Ability to supervise, direct, and review RSM USI and team members, as needed
Preferred
Master’s degree
Working knowledge of the system of quality management standards
Ability to respond positively to changing circumstances, seek and implement change to drive business improvement
